Antoine Semenyo scores in Bristol City’s draw against Blackburn Rovers

Antoine Semenyo scored to earn Bristol City a point in their game against Blackburn Rovers in the English Championship on Saturday afternoon at Ashton Gate.

After 54 minutes, Blackburn took the lead when Tyler Morton, who had gotten in behind City’s defense on the right, pulled back a brilliant cross for Bradley Dack to score from eight yards.

However, Bristol City equalized 14 minutes later when Rovers goalkeeper Thomas Kaminski parried a drive from beyond the area by Zak Vyner, and Antoine Semenyo scored on the rebound.

In the 74th minute, Ayala was given a second yellow card for pushing back Nahki Wells as he was about to break free, which sent Blackburn down to ten men.

Despite a difficult start to the season due to an injury, Antoine Semenyo has six goals in the English Championship. The 23-year-old has made 23 appearances for the Robins in the English Championship.
